Congratulations to Great Neck endurance athletes Michael Ginor and Amy Goldstein, who successfully completed the Nassau-Suffolk Greenbelt Trail 50-Kilometer Run on May 20. The 42-year-old Ginor completed the 31.07 mile course in 7 hours, 38 minutes, 18 seconds, and the 46-year-old Goldstein crossed the finish line at the Greater Long Island Running Club's Plainview facility in 10 hours, 03 minutes, 09 seconds.

Long Island will never be mistaken for Colorado or Utah, and the hills of Long Island's North Shore will never be mistaken for the Rockies or the Sierras. Nevertheless, the Nassau-Suffolk Greenbelt Trail 50-Kilometer Run does present a definite challenge, and one that should not be taken lightly. The double out-and-back format maximizes the difficulties created by some tough uphills and bone-jarring downhills in the Lawrence Hill and Cold Spring Harbor sections of the course, especially the second time around. There's also the psychological factor of having to face the same nasty hills a second time, especially when it is so easy and tempting to bail out at the trailhead at 16 miles only a half mile from the finish line. All in all, Michael and Amy can take justifiable pride in their accomplishments.
